  • Abstract
    OpenVPN is an open source Virtual Private Networks product providing cross-platform, secure, highly configurable VPN solutions. Tablet computers seem to be directing many of the emerging trends in the marketing industry at the moment. For this case study, the performance of OpenVPN on Android is measured and analyzed using various configurations parameters including protocol, cipher and compression. The results show that the throughput is mainly impacted by the data compression used, and that the round-trip time is mostly dependent on the transport protocol selected.
